About NEB

New England Biolabsis a different kind ofbiotechnology company we areacommunity of scientists innovators and collaborators driven by a shared mission to advance scienceforthe benefit ofsociety. Founded in 1974 with a deep commitment to research excellence and environmental stewardship NEB has become a global leader in the discovery and production of enzymes for molecular biology applications. Our reagents are trusted by researchers worldwide for their quality and reliability and have played a critical role in breakthroughs across genomics proteomics diagnostics and academic research. The role

We are inviting applications for the position of Automation Development Scientist I/II. The successful candidate will work as a member of the Applications and Product Development Department. This individual will be responsible for designing developing optimizing and maintaining laboratory automation workflows in support of product development activities at NEB. This position offers opportunities to strategize optimize processes learn from colleagues and align with other groups and departments across the company to deliver impactful solutions.


How youll contribute:

  • Design build and validate end-to-end laboratory automation protocols for highthroughput NGS sequencing/other technologies using liquid handlers and other integrated instrumentation

  • Optimize existing workflows to enhance reliability reproducibility precision and throughput

  • Troubleshoot automation performance issues across hardware software and functional assays

  • Implement and maintain high throughput automation platforms

  • Evaluate new automation technologies and lead pilots or onboarding of new equipment.

  • Partner with SMEs to translate manual assays into automated methods.

  • Develop documentation SOPs and training materials for automated workflows.

  • Provide hands-on training and support to lab teams on automated protocols platforms and best practices

  • Assist customers with technical inquiries regarding NEB products

  • Work closely across the Applications and Development teams and other departments to integrate automation solutions that accelerate discovery

Required Qualifications and Experience:

  • PhD in biochemistry molecular biology or related field with minimum 2 years of experience (or masters with 5 years of experience)

  • Experience in protocol design troubleshooting and implementation on various liquid handling platforms (such as Agilent Bravo Hamilton Revvity Beckman SPT Labtech etc.)

  • Working knowledge of LIMS/ELN integration data pipelines and experiment tracking systems

  • Have good hands with proven bench skills

  • Strong ability to multi-task self-manage and perform effectively in a fast-paced team

  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ills

  • Be goal and deadline oriented with exceptional attention to detail

  • Have a strong work ethic emphasizing integrity efficiency and quality of work

What will make you stand out:

  • Experience in molecular biology techniques high-throughput screening (HTS) or assay development preferred

  • Knowledge of Next Generation Sequencing workflows preferred
